网易云服务器开光影

云服务器

网易云服务器开光影

2026-01-03 21:41


30字描述句: 网易云服务器光影部署指南,解析三种架构及优化配置实现高效率实时渲染与稳定性保障。

网易云服务器开光影:高效部署与配置指南

对于寻求在云端运行高性能图形处理项目或特殊特效场景的用户,网易云服务器凭借其稳定的计算资源和灵活的架构,为光线追踪专业开箱提供了可靠支持。本文将深入讲解如何在该平台部署光影系统的关键操作与优化策略,帮助用户实现流畅的视觉呈现。


方式一:基础多线程处理模型

硬件选型的关键参数解析

在开启光影效果前,需优先考虑实例规格选择。推荐至少配置8核CPU与16GB内存的机型,例如C6超高内存系列,确保能同时处理物理引擎运算与图形渲染任务。固态硬盘(SSD)作为存储介质时,读取速度可提升至2000MB/s以上,有效减少场景加载时延。对于实时光影追踪需求,可优先选择支持NVIDIA GPU的机型,但需注意显卡驱动版本适配性。

系统优化三步曲

  1. 环境变量调整
    通过/etc/environment文件设置JVM最大堆栈大小,例如:

    JVM_OPTS="-Xmx8192m -Xms4096m"

    配合Linux内核参数调优:

    sysctl.vm.swappiness=10

    保障内存分配策略与图形处理需求匹配

  2. Linux权限管理
    建立专用的(ray/scene)用户组,分离服务器核心进程与图形渲染模块的访问权限。使用SELinux白名单配置方式,对特定渲染目录开放读写权限,例如:

    chcon -t user_home_t /capturing_data

    并通过firewalld设置限制性网络策略

  3. 图形渲染路径规划
    在欲渲染的区域提前预加载所有建筑物纹理资源。通过以下命令批量导入:

    find /built/objects/* -name "*.obj" -exec render --hash {} \+

    并记录每个渲染单元的性能消耗指标

稳定运行的保障机制

部署完成后需持续监测服务器负载。推荐使用htop配合动态内存统计插件,每30分钟进行一次top输出采集。同时设置内核堆栈溢出保护:

echo "kernel.core_pattern=core/neon-%e.%t" >> /etc/cmdline

并配置ulimit -v最高堆栈限制为2GB。测试阶段使用strace -tf追踪渲染进程,特别关注glDrawArray指令的执行频率与耗时。


方式二:GPU加速的特效演算方案

CUDA架构扩展部署

对于使用实时光影追踪的应用场景,需特别注意实例的显卡驱动状态。推荐采用以下验证流程:

  1. 安装NVIDIA显卡驱动
  2. 验证CUDA工具版本匹配度
  3. 使用clinfo确认OpenCL运行环境

特别提醒:在像素拼接模式(vulkan)下运算时,需额外配置显存预留参数:

CUDA_CACHE_PATH=/render/temporal_lights

热量监测与性能预留

云服务器运行动态光影负载时,需重点关注CPU利用率阈值。推荐设置动态超频规则:

undervolt VDDCORE 150MV at 80°C

同时预留20%非渲染核心作为备用,应对突发场景切换。通过msr工具动态调整tempo_freq参数,可有效提升计算资源的利用率。


方式三:离线渲染阵列模型

分布式负载均衡方案

大规模光影运算时,建议采用主从式架构。例如,部署至少一主四从的渲染节点集群,每个节点独立处理不同的渲染区域。通过screen -list命令管理多个渲染进程,确保任意单节点异常时仍能保持基本渲染能力。

参数优化策略

模块 优化参数 优势效果
光影引擎 rays_per_px=2 在保证画质95%的前提下提升80%帧率
物理模型 grain=512 显着减少粒子模拟所需内存开销
拼接引擎 board=0.5ms 帧延迟控制在0.5秒以内

网络传输的效能提升

建议在非加速模式下使用流式传输协议。具体实现步骤:

  1. 在OLT服务器(Online Lighting Tracker)启用socket监听
  2. 配置渲染结果的16bit深度通道
  3. 使用roadmap模式降低实时响应指标至安全值
  4. 采用内存映射文件方式加速数据交换

通过调整render_wait参数至1000ms,可保持每次光线追踪结果的完整性。使用以下CPU调度指令优先级设置:

sudo nice -15 /render/init_process

三种运行架构的比较分析

适用场景对比表

架构类型 适用场景 优点 注意事项
基础模式 自定义粒子特效开发 清零状态快照更稳定 应重点关注每个Quad的更新周期
GPU加速模式 实时日照情况模拟 支持实时热能扩散模型 风扇转速监控模块必装
阵列模式 城市规划可视化项目 允许同时处理多个大范围场景 必须配置负载分布监控界面

此处着重比较了三种典型的应用架构,各模块间性能差异可达2-5倍。用户可根据实际需求灵活选择供应商的GPU型号,但需注意保持计算核心与图形核心的版本一致性。


网络通信的边界控制

虚拟化环境的优化配置

在设置渲染任务时,建议通过env方式指定渲染帧数:

export VANGLE_THREADS=8

并配置vangle_limit达到20000的推荐值。针对每个独立任务建立独立的dmso空间,防止程序崩溃导致服务器锁死。经验表明,使用混合pta与padding区域可达25%的性能提升。

跨端验证的测试方法

推荐采用独享的input参数验证光影系统:

render args: skip=setup | input_fragment=1

并通过对照实验生成四种不同层级的运行报告。对于光照情况特别复杂的场景(如多建筑堆积区域),建议开启预渲染模式,提升第一次场景构建效率。


通过上述多层次策略规划,即使在完全关闭olcs模式的前提下,也能保证基本的矩阵运算能力。实际应用中,不同场景需要测试12-24小时以确定最终参数,特别是针对magic plant类型的模型需特别关注内存泄漏风险。最终效果测试建议生成video_xx格式的基准测试报告,在客户提供原始地形数据前,确保选择合适的渲染模式。


标签: 网易云服务器 光影系统 GPU加速 CUDA架构 分布式负载均衡